When I found out I was pregnant, I signed up for babycenter.com, a website all about pregnancy and babies. Each week, they send me an email "update" on what Baby Anglin is up to. Here's what they say about 12 weeks:

The most dramatic development this week: reflexes. Your baby's fingers will soon begin to open and close, his/her toes will curl, his/her eye muscles will clench, and his/her mouth will make sucking movements. In fact, if you prod your abdomen, your baby will squirm in response (although you won't be able to feel it). His/her face looks unquestionably human: the eyes have moved from the sides to the front of the head, and the ears are right where they should be. From crown to rump, your baby is just over 2 inches long (the size of a lime).
